Moist Chocolate Cake Recipe

  • 1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up hot brewed coffee
  • 1/2 cup butter or margarine
  • 1 cup white s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• Frosting:
  • 1 1/2 cups confectioners' sugar
  • 1 cup cocoa powder
  • 1/2 cup butter or margarine
  • 1 1/4 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up hot milk
  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our a 9×13 or two 9 inch round pans. Sift together the flour, baking powder, baking soda and salt. Set aside. In a small bowl, combine hot coffee with 1 cup cocoa and let cool to lukewarm.
  2. In a large bowl, cream together the 1/2 cup butter and 1 cup sugar until light and fluffy. Add the eggs one at a time, beating well with each addition, then stir in the 1 teaspoon vanilla. Add the flour mixture alternately with the coffee and cocoa mixture; beat well.
  3. Pour batter into a 9×13 inch cake or two 9 inch round pans. Bake in the preheated oven for 45 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the cake comes out clean. Allow to cool.
  4. To make the frosting: In a medium bowl, combine confectioners sugar, 1 cup cocoa, 1/2 cup butter and 1 1/4 teaspoons vanilla. Mix until smooth. Add hot milk a teaspoon at a time to make a smooth, spreadable consistency. Spread onto cooled cake.
